Name: Isis
Origin: southern Ninraih
Residence: Moves around
Romantic inclination: Bisexual
Race: Korcai
Hair: Black straight half way down her back
Skin: Brown
Eyes: Golden with white pupil
Height: 5'10"
Dress: usually dresses in clothing that's easy to move in such as a belly dancer outfit
Class: Monk
Age: 237 looks 23
Maker: Horus
Bio: when she was found dying alone of a fatal illness Horus offered a rare act of mercy. At least to him, he would gift her with his blood so that she might live on. However, she would no longer be alive. The woman needed little time to think about it and accepted gratefully. Now she calls Horus her Walid(Father)

Name: Hawthorne Carnation
Location: Ajteire
Romantic Orientation: Heterosexual
Race: Fae
Gender: female
Hair: Violet shoulder length
Eyes: green
Height: 4'8"
Age: 315
Job: bard
Note: blue wings
Dress: a flowing one piece dress of a bright color that shows off her legs nicely.

Bio: When she was a little into her first century she came down with a incurable toxic illness. However, her sister brought the Luck Dragon Dessrexin to her aid. Thankfully, he was able to cure her. So she has spent her time since then becoming a bard who affectionately calls her work Hawthorne's Histories. She wants to make sure legends are never forgotten.
